1. Select a topic that meets the requirements of your assignment.
2. Explore information: explore ideas and perspectives and identify potential sources of information.
3. Narrow your topic: identify key points you want to explore and formulate a question or argument around them.
4. Refine your search & evaluate resources: explore information related to your argument and make connections between your ideas and the ideas of others.
5. Use information appropriately: give credit to the original creators of information and strengthen your argument with citations and references.

Topic Call Number
Symbolism of Numbers (Numerology) | BF1623 .P9 |
Statistics | HA+ |
Commercial Mathematics | HF5691 - 5716 |
Teaching Math | LB1186 |
Mathematics Classrooms | LB3325 .M35 |
Pharmaceutical Arithmetic | RS57 |
Mathematics for Nurses | RT68 |
Mathematics | QA+ |
Surveying | TA556 .M38 |
Carpentry and Joinery Mathematics | TH5612+ |
Electronics | TK7864 |
Chemical Engineering Mathematics | TP155.2 .M36 |
Hotels, clubs, restaurants, etc. | TX911.3 .M33 |
